Guillain-Barré syndrome in children often follows infection, causing sudden paralysis. While many children recover, some experience long-term deficits, with age and disease duration impacting prognosis.

Summary:

  • This retrospective study reviewed 71 pediatric Guillain-Barré syndrome cases, noting infection preceded 50% of cases.
  • Key findings include a mean age of 5.5 years, sudden onset in 65%, and significant motor deficits.
  • Cerebrospinal fluid protein elevation was common (73%), with 53% regaining motility within a month; however, 31% had residual deficits after 3+ years.

Impact:

  • The study highlights the variability in pediatric Guillain-Barré syndrome presentation and recovery.
  • Identifies age, extension phase duration, and plateau phase duration as critical prognostic factors.
  • Informs clinical management and counseling for families regarding GBS outcomes in children.
